Ingredients – Hillbilly Pizza

To make Hillbilly Pizza, you will need a few simple ingredients. These are easy to find at any grocery store:

For the dough:

  • 2 ½ c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 packet (2 ¼ tsp) active dry yeast
  • 1 cup warm water (about 110°F)
  • 1 tbsp sugar
  • 1 tsp salt
  • 2 tbsp olive oil

For the toppings:

  • 1/2 pound ground hamburger (beef)
  • 1/2 pound Italian sausage (remove casing if needed)
  • 1 cup sliced pepperoni
  • 2 cups shredded mozzarella cheese
  • 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
  • 1 cup pizza sauce (store-bought or homemade)
  • 1 tsp garlic powder
  • 1 tsp dried oregano
  • 1/2 tsp black pepper
  • 1 tbsp olive oil (for cooking meat)

Step by Step Process – Hillbilly Pizza

Here’s how you can make this delicious Hillbilly Pizza at home. Follow these steps carefully, and you’ll have a deep dish pizza full of flavor.

Step 1: Prepare the Dough

  1. In a small bowl, mix warm water, sugar, and yeast. Let it sit for 5-10 minutes until it becomes frothy. This means the yeast is active.
  2. In a large bowl, combine flour and salt.
  3. Add the yeast mixture and olive oil to the flour. Stir until the dough starts to come together.
  4. Knead the dough on a clean surface for about 5-7 minutes until it’s smooth and elastic.
  5. Put the dough in a greased bowl, cover it with a cloth, and let it rise for about 1 hour or until it doubles in size.

Step 2: Cook the Meat

  1. Heat olive oil in a skillet over medium heat.
  2. Add the ground hamburger and Italian sausage. Break the meat into small pieces with a spatula.
  3. Cook until the meat is browned and no longer pink, about 7-10 minutes.
  4. Drain any excess fat from the skillet.
  5. Sprinkle garlic powder, oregano, and black pepper on the meat. Stir well and remove from heat.

Step 3: Preheat the Oven and Prepare the Pan

  1. Pre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C).
  2. Grease a deep dish pizza pan or a 9-inch round cake pan with olive oil. This will help the crust become crispy.

Step 4: Shape the Dough

  1. Punch down the risen dough to remove air bubbles.
  2. Roll or press the dough into the greased pan, covering the bottom and sides evenly. The dough should be thick enough to hold all the toppings.

Step 5: Add the Toppings

  1. Spread the pizza sauce evenly over the dough base.
  2. Sprinkle half of the mozzarella and cheddar cheese on top of the sauce.
  3. Add the cooked hamburger and sausage mixture evenly over the cheese.
  4. Arrange the pepperoni slices on top of the meat.
  5. Add the remaining cheese over everything. This will help seal in all the flavors.

Step 6: Bake the Pizza

  1. Place the pizza in the oven and bake for 25-30 minutes.
  2. Check if the crust is golden brown and the cheese is bubbly and melted.
  3. If the top is browning too fast, cover loosely with aluminum foil and continue baking until done.

Step 7: Serve and Enjoy

  1. Remove the pizza from the oven and let it cool for 5 minutes.
  2. Slice the pizza into pieces and serve hot.
  3. Enjoy your hearty, cheesy Hillbilly Pizza!

Frequently Asked Questions

1. Can I make Hillbilly Pizza without sausage?

Yes! You can replace sausage with extra hamburger or other meats like bacon or ham.

2. Can I use pre-made pizza dough?

Absolutely! Using store-bought dough saves time and works well for this recipe.

3. Is this pizza spicy?

No, it is not spicy by default. But you can add crushed red pepper flakes or spicy sausage if you want some heat.

4. Can I freeze leftovers?

Yes, this pizza freezes well. Wrap leftover slices in foil or plastic wrap and freeze up to 2 months. Reheat in the oven for best results.

5. Can I add vegetables?

Sure! You can add onions, bell peppers, mushrooms, or any veggies you like to the meat mixture or on top before baking.
